Hi, i am fairly new to revit but have been trying to use an interior view looking outwards of a large curtain wall.

 

http://www.cadclips.com/Search.aspx then typed in 'background' - this then leads to the tutorial download

 

I have tried the CAD clip which requires downloading involving a putting the rendered image and a tif file then importing it over a jpeg background image. I have found that this only works with placing the building in a background and will not show the image through the windows.

Help would be very appreciated as this image is essential for my architectural project.
